May I say an extra special thanks to Derry and Beamends for correctly advising me look in the selector assembly before stripping the LT77 in the Range Rover.
As soon as I took the centre console apart you could see that the flat plate of metal between the two springs had broken and wedged themselves inbetween the two retaining bolts. Off with the top of the box, back on with one of the scrapper disco and all up and running again within 2 hours. Wonderful.
I've yet to drive it on the road but running through the gears with the transfer box in neutral the shift is actually better that it has ever been. Very precise.
